The Rakuyaku Chinese website has a lot of resources in Japanese for learning Chinese. Including their regular dictionary, they also have a "conversation" dictionary -- type in a common phrase in Japanese to get the Chinese equivalent. Also, for those working on their pronunciation, the main page has an application that lets you type in pinyin and hear how it should sound. There is also a section for searching the traditional equivalent of a simplified character, or even the Japanese kanji version. Very nifty!
